IN DETAIL:

The public is invited to join the Mohegan Tribe at their annual Mohegan Wigwam Festival at Fort Shantok, Village of Uncas, on Saturday, August 18 and Sunday, August 19 from 10:00am to 7:00pm.

Learn more about Mohegan culture and traditions including Native American crafts, foods, dancing and drumming. The festival is open to all ages, is family-friendly and admission is free. No pets, please.

Parking is at Mohegan Sun’s Thames Garage and shuttles will run throughout the day, each day (including for handicapped guests). There is no onsite parking available.
